Benefit dinner dance to honor former police chief

36

Northborough – The Northborough Interfaith Clergy Association (NICA) will hold a dinner dance banquet that will honor former Northborough Chief of Police Ken Hutchins and his wife Priscilla for their many years of generous service in town. This event will benefit NICA's Voucher Fund which assists town residents in crisis with vouchers for food, fuel oil, gasoline, and emergency shelter.

The Dinner Dance will be held at the White Cliffs Banquet Facility, 167 Main St., Saturday, Nov. 9, beginning with a cocktail hour at 6 p.m. followed by dinner, dancing and presentations. A silent auction and gift basket raffle will also be held.
